Reinhard/anyone: how do you create GFD files currently?
By hand in a text editor, only - or with the help of some script?
[sorry if this was already answered; i do not see record in gnue-dev archive
of recent months, and irc-logs are empty since 2010-09.]
One of my thoughts, which I had not yet spelled out on the maillist, is
a command-line script to generate a basic GFD file from a schema, like
what we would expect from the Designer wizard/druid.
(I see something about gnue-schema, which generates schema SQL-DDL from XML,
but I'm more interested in the other way around, generate GFD-XML from
schema.)
Purpose of such script would be two-fold:
* useful on its own, before getting Designer up & running, maybe still after;
* unit test or proof of concept of code to be adaptable for Designer.
Strategy of such script would be as follows:
1. adapt portions of legacy Designer (0.5) wizard to a command-line script,
but generate new-style hbox/vbox GFD rather than legacy x-y GFD.
2. adapt generation of hbox/vbox GFD from script to Designer.
